How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Claremont?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Claremont Studio Apartments | $2,034 | $1,800 | $2,305 |
| Claremont 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,298 | $825 | $3,000 |
| Claremont 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,577 | $1,500 | $4,200 |
| Claremont 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,613 | $1,850 | $5,500 |
| Claremont 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,970 | $2,300 | $3,500 |
